Output 2c5e51c9ea0e8fae3c75c7d71cda1a79397cc17caf87256552916247f3ca4838:26

value
36085077
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b8f42a75fc469f08ee6b0fc93a987af2a6e72ef OP_EQUAL
address
34CjndNduwb1vjMFsUVrgiSfNtXTwaBXgQ
transaction
2c5e51c9ea0e8fae3c75c7d71cda1a79397cc17caf87256552916247f3ca4838
spent
true